My Wife asked me to drive her to a Karate tournament in Quebec City this weekend (she won 2nd place). It allowed me to visit Cap-Tormente Reserve just outside of Ste-Anne du Beaupre, a major stop over point for Snow Geese on their migration north. I wasn't disappointed, over 100,000 geese in the area. I managed to get great upgrade photos for my collection, Blue, White and Juvenile..even managed to find a Ross's Goose, at an extreme crop. I could get fairly close, tried to get some up close flight shots and landing shots.
